Literature summary extracted from

  • Schuermann, J.P.; White, T.A.; Srivastava, D.; Karr, D.B.; Tanner, J.J.
    Three crystal forms of the bifunctional enzyme proline utilization A (PutA) from Bradyrhizobium japonicum (2008), Acta Crystallogr. Sect. F, 64, 949-953.

Crystallization (Commentary)

EC Number Crystallization (Comment) Organism
1.5.99.B2 His-tag removed, three crystal forms: apparent tetragonal, hexagonal and centered monoclinic Bradyrhizobium japonicum
